Directed by
Clement Virgo
Starring
Kiana Madeira, Lamar Johnson, Marsha Stephanie Blake, Aaron Pierre, Alsseny Camara, Delia Lisette Chambers

During a hot summer in 1991, two brothers, Francis and Michael, growing up in Toronto's vibrant hip-hop scene, face the challenges of adolescence. As Caribbean immigrant sons, they grapple with identity and the complexities of family. A growing mystery emerges, creating lasting consequences and testing the bond between them. The story explores themes of sibling loyalty, the strength of community, and the influence of music during a pivotal time in their lives.

What Is Brother About? (No Spoilers)

The plot of Brother (2023) without spoilers: what it is about, who it follows and where it takes place, told without the twists or the ending. Enough to decide whether it is your next watch, not enough to ruin it.

In the sweltering summer of 1991, Toronto’s streets pulse with the raw energy of a burgeoning hip‑hop scene, a soundtrack that frames the lives of two brothers navigating the cusp of adulthood. Francis—the older, steadier sibling—carries the weight of expectations set by a community that has long fought to carve out its place in a new country. His younger brother, Michael, is restless and inventive, drawn to the beats and verses that promise both escape and expression. Together they stride through neighborhoods where Caribbean roots intertwine with the gritty urban rhythm, their conversation a blend of slang, song, and the unspoken questions that come with growing up between cultures.

Their family, a close‑knit unit of immigrant parents and extended relatives, offers both shelter and a mirror for the brothers’ evolving identities. The home is alive with the aromas of home‑cooked meals, the cadence of stories from a distant island, and the hopeful ambition of a generation eager to define itself on its own terms. Within this vibrant mosaic, the brothers grapple with the subtle pressures of belonging—whether to the legacy of their heritage, the expectations of their community, or the magnetic pull of the city’s ever‑changing landscape.

Amid the summer heat, a quietly growing mystery threads through their world, hinting at deeper currents beneath the surface of everyday life. It is a mystery that feels less like a confrontation and more like a question mark hovering over the rhythm of their days, urging the pair to look beyond the surface of the beats they love. As the music swells and the city lights flicker, the bond between Francis and Michael is tested, revealing the fragile yet resilient ties that hold family, community, and self together. The tone remains intimate and lyrical, inviting viewers to feel the cadence of a time and place where every rhyme carries the weight of history and the promise of tomorrow.
